"If you go to the book...From previous comment:<br />"If you go to the books website. It links to a govenerment study. The annex of the study gives specific test results on vehicles, etc. The net result is that the book exagerates the effects on electronics and vehicles. Vehicles stall, but can be turned back on."<br /><br />The energy density generated by a nuclear blast in space at various altitudes are classified to prevent giving bad actors the recipe for this type of weapon. But as a data point the Soviets designed EMP weapons that would generate energy densities many time those that were used in the test referenced above. The nuclear tests Star Fish Prime not only took out the electrical grid in Hawaii but also radios that used vacuum tubes, which are much more resilient than our modern electronics.<br /><br />One Second After is an accurate description (if our adversaries get things right) from a technical and social standpoint.DWh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/09262587917905900259no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-8294304458677955232.post-22187990291868749362011-02-22T17:55:49.213-08:002011-02-22T17:55:49.213-08:00I am also studying herbal medicine, Beth. It's...I am also studying herbal medicine, Beth. It's so interesting, and amazing to see various herbs bring about immediate results, with no side effects. <br /><br />I just wanted to recommend, if you haven't read them already: Principles and Practice of Phytotherapy, by Mills & Bone; The New Holistic Herbal, by David Hoffman; 50 Most Common Medicinal Herbs, by Boon & Smith; and Bartram's Encyclopedia of Herbal Medicine. <br /><br />P & P is an essential text, in my opinion, with all the traditional info plus detailed scientific studies, plus the treatment philosopy and context; Hoffman's is a great overview and quick reference, despite some new age philospohy; 50 Most Common Herbs is based more on the clinical studies; and Bartram's is a more detailed reference guide. I use all four of these books together in my work; they seem to fill each others gaps.Anonymousnore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-8294304458677955232.post-48212083422923806932011-02-22T15:26:48.346-08:002011-02-22T15:26:48.346-08:00One Second After was the book that scared the prep...One Second After was the book that scared the prepper/survivalist into me.Violethttps://www.blogger.com/profile/03687244265915794402no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-8294304458677955232.post-40446560617948763842011-02-22T12:34:31.528-08:002011-02-22T12:34:31.528-08:00I've been thinking about this subject a lot, l...I've been thinking about this subject a lot, lately.
